Output 8cd31bb8825756bf2028930850e2628a50b729712ddb8288c5c370a37bc13259:1

value
70906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bad4cba685a7ff784d0db007888c80ae0b38d95e7a296d6526132a9b4c4ece56
address
bc1pht2vhf595llhsngdkqrc3ryq4c9n3k270g5k6efxzv4fknzweetqhqnza0
transaction
8cd31bb8825756bf2028930850e2628a50b729712ddb8288c5c370a37bc13259
spent
true